What is Kenya?

Kenya is one of East Africa's most studied nations, appearing across disciplines including political science, economics, international business, public health, and postcolonial studies. Its position as a regional hub, its history of independence and subsequent nation-building, and its experience with ethnic conflict and governance challenges make it a rich subject for academic inquiry. Students writing about Kenya are often asked to examine how a developing nation navigates economic growth, political instability, and social transformation simultaneously, which raises substantive questions about government effectiveness, regional influence, and national identity.

A strong essay on Kenya benefits from a clearly scoped thesis that connects a specific dimension of the country — its economy, governance, conflict history, or public health system — to a broader analytical argument. Evidence drawn from policy analysis, economic data, or documented historical events carries the most weight. A common pitfall is treating Kenya as a generic stand-in for "Africa," which flattens the country's distinct regional identity, internal diversity, and particular postcolonial trajectory.
